African Union warns of huge risk of partition in Sudan

Rapid Support Forces (RSF) deputy commander Major Gen Abdul Rahim Hamdan Dagalo(centre) with Sudan People's Liberation Movement-North (SPLM-N) Leader Abdel Aziz Al-Hilu(left) and Fadlallah Burma(right), the leader of Sudan's National Umma Party (NUP) during the postponned signing of Sudan Founding Charter for establishing a peace and unity Government, at KICC, Nairobi on February 18, 2025.[Boniface Okendo, Standard]

The African Union on Wednesday said the announcement of a parallel government in war-torn Sudan risked cleaving the country, already ravaged by nearly two years of unrest.
